Fall Fine & Decorative Arts Auction

A diverse grouping of wonderful objects including items by Tiffany Studios; artwork by Eric Sloane, Ernest Fiene, George Bellows, Guy Carleton Wiggins, American school artists, and others; folk art including trade signs, samplers, fraktur, cut-work valentines; furniture including Continental & American (William & Mary, Queen Anne, Chippendale, Hepplewhite); Asian arts including Chinese porcelain, pottery, jade, and stone carvings and Japanese metalworks and porcelain; First Nation objects including McKenney and Hall, pottery, baskets, textiles; antique firearms; historical americana; stoneware; early lighting; art glass; sterling silver; coins; jewelry and accessories from Tiffany & Co., Cartier, Gucci, Chanel, and Louis Vuitton.
